Terracotta fragment of a kylix (drinking cup)
Attributed to the Painter of London E 777
Not on view
Interior, draped woman to right wearing a sakkos, chiton, and himation; behind her, a block seat; draped youth to left, seen from the back, which is in three-quarter view, with his right hand on his hip, leaning on a knobby stick; behind him, a rock?; Obverse, drapery, feet, and stick of male to right; lower drapery and feet of male; drapery, stick, and feet of male to left; handle palmettes and tendrils; Reverse, drapery and feet of male to left, with a stick; drapery and right foot of male to right
